Why Retrofitting Beats a Total Replacement

I get asked a lot why somebody shouldn't just buy a brand-new LED fixture and end up being done with this. While new accessories are great, these people come with a great deal of extra suitcases. If you draw out the whole troffer, you're coping with dirt, debris, and potentially mismatched ceiling ceramic tiles. Plus, you're spending for a lot of metal casing that you currently own.

Using a led troffer retrofit kit allows you to skip the large lifting. You're basically buying the LED strips and the particular driver (the "brain" that replaces the particular old ballast) and fitting them into the shell you curently have. It's a method more sustainable way to upgrade due to the fact you aren't throwing out perfectly good metal boxes. You save on labor too, since a pro can usually pop these types of inside a fraction of the time it will take to wire up a whole brand-new unit.

Picking the Right Style regarding Your Space

Not all products are built the particular same, and you'll want to pick one that fits the particular vibe of your own room. Generally, you'll see two primary types: the "door" kits and the "strip" kits.

Door products are pretty awesome because they in fact replace the entire bottom frame plus lens of your own fixture. When you're done, it looks like you set up a brand-new, modern architectural light. They often have a wonderful center-basket design that softens the light and gets rid of these harsh "stare-into-the-sun" hotspots.

On the other hand, if you're searching to save as much cash as possible and don't care an excessive amount of about the aesthetics of the light fixture itself, a strip-style led troffer retrofit kit is the way to go. These just mount within the existing box so you put the old lens back on. Through the floor, it looks the same since it did prior to, but the gentle quality is infinitely better.

The Installation Reality Check out

I won't lie and state these install on their own, but they're certainly within the world of the DIY project if you're comfortable with basic wiring. The big thing to remember is that you're skipping the old electrical ballast. Those heavy, heat-producing boxes are the main reason fluorescent lighting fail or hype, so getting rid of them is a huge win.

Many kits come along with magnetic strips or easy-to-install brackets. You switch off the power (seriously, don't skip that part), pull out the older tubes, snip the wires to the particular ballast, and connect the new LED driver. It's generally just a several wire nuts plus you're good to go. Many people find that will after they do the first one and get the hang up of it, the rest of the particular room goes by incredibly fast.

Better Light, Better Mood

It's easy to neglect how much lighting affects how we all feel. Old fluorescents often have the lowest Color Rendering Index (CRI), which is why everything looks kind of grey and washed away in some offices. The quality led troffer retrofit kit usually has a very much higher CRI, signifying colors look radiant and "true. "

You also get to select your color temperature. If you prefer a warm, cozy feel for the breakroom, you are able to go with 3000K. If you want that crisp, "daylight" feel that will keep people alert and focused in the warehouse or workplace, 4000K or 5000K is the nice spot. Many modern kits are in fact "selectable, " meaning there's a little switch on the driving force that lets a person change the color temperature or brightness upon the fly. It's a great function in case you aren't very sure what will certainly look best until it's actually upon the ceiling.

A Few Things to Watch Out there For

Before you go away and buy a pallet of these, make sure you measure your own existing fixtures. Many troffers are possibly 2x2 or 2x4 feet, but several older buildings have weird, non-standard dimensions. Additionally you want to check if your existing fixtures are usually dimmable. If a person want to have the ability to dim your lights, you'll need to make sure the particular led troffer retrofit kit you pick is compatible with 0-10V dimming systems, that is the standard intended for commercial spaces.

Also, keep an eye on the "lumens" rather than just the wattage. Lumens tell a person how bright the particular light actually is. A person might find that a lower-wattage LED kit actually puts out more lighting than your aged 3-lamp fluorescent fitting did.
